Layer vs. Broiler Poultry Cage: What’s the Difference?

The poultry industry relies heavily on specialized equipment to maximize productivity and animal welfare. Among the most critical components are poultry breeding cages, chicken coops, and poultry housing systems, each designed to meet the unique needs of different bird types. This article explores the functional differences between cages for layer chickens (egg producers) and broilers (meat producers), focusing on design principles, operational requirements, and suitability for modern farming practices.

 

Layer vs. Broiler Poultry Cage: What’s the Difference?

 

Poultry Breeding Cage: Tailoring Designs for Layers and Broilers

 

The foundation of efficient poultry farming lies in selecting the right poultry breeding cage. For layer chickens, cages are engineered to prioritize egg collection efficiency and hen comfort. These systems often feature sloped flooring to allow eggs to roll gently into collection trays, minimizing breakage. Perches and nesting areas are integrated to mimic natural behaviors, reducing stress and improving egg quality.

 

In contrast, broiler cages prioritize space optimization and weight gain. Since broilers are bred for rapid growth, their housing requires sturdier construction to support heavier birds. The flooring in broiler cages is typically flat to prevent leg injuries, with adjustable feeders and waterers that accommodate their increasing size. Ventilation systems in broiler poultry housing must also be more robust to manage higher moisture levels from dense bird populations.

Chicken Coop Layouts: Balancing Space and Functionality

 

A well-designed chicken coop is vital for maintaining bird health. For layer chicken cages, vertical stacking (battery cages) is common to maximize space without compromising egg accessibility. This design allows farmers to house thousands of hens in a compact area while ensuring easy access for feeding, cleaning, and egg collection.

 

Broiler poultry housing, however, often employs single-tier systems. Since meat birds require more floor space to prevent overcrowding, these coops focus on horizontal expansion. The absence of vertical tiers simplifies daily management and reduces the risk of injury during handling.

Poultry Housing: Environmental Control for Optimal Performance

 

Effective poultry housing must regulate temperature, humidity, and airflow. Layer operations demand stable environments to sustain consistent egg production. Automated climate control systems in layer chicken cages maintain temperatures between 20–24°C, with lighting schedules calibrated to simulate natural daylight cycles.

 

Broiler housing emphasizes rapid growth, requiring warmer conditions (28–32°C) during early growth stages. High-capacity ventilation systems are critical to dissipate ammonia from dense populations. Layer Chicken Cage Innovations: Enhancing Egg Production Safely

 

Modern layer chicken cages incorporate advancements like roll-away egg belts and anti-pecking grids. These features reduce labor costs and minimize egg contamination. Additionally, cage materials are designed to resist corrosion from frequent cleaning, a necessity in humid environments.

FAQs: Layer vs. Broiler Poultry Cage

 

What distinguishes a layer chicken cage from a broiler coop?


Layer cages prioritize egg collection and hen comfort with sloped floors and nesting areas, while broiler coops focus on space management and sturdiness to support rapid growth.

 

Can one poultry housing system work for both layers and broilers?


Specialized designs are recommended. Layers require vertical space for egg collection, whereas broilers need horizontal layouts to prevent overcrowding.

 

How does chicken coop design affect bird health?


Proper ventilation, spacing, and flooring reduce disease risks. Layer cages prevent egg breakage, while broiler systems minimize leg injuries.

 

Are automated systems necessary in poultry breeding cages?


Automation improves efficiency in large operations, particularly for feeding and climate control, but smaller farms can opt for semi-manual setups.

 

Why choose galvanized steel for poultry housing?


Galvanized steel resists rust and withstands frequent cleaning, ensuring longevity in humid or high-moisture environments.
